How to Calibrate a Measurement Setup using an External Generator
1. Connect the signal generator's GPIB interface connector to the EXT.
GEN.CONTROL GPIB connector on the rear panel of the R&S
FSW.
2. Connect the signal generator output to the RF INPUT connector on the front panel
of the R&S
FSW.
3. If the signal generator supports TTL synchronization, connect the signal generator
to the FSW - B10 AUX.CONTROL port.
4. If the measurement setup does not require the full span of the R&S
FSW, change
the "Frequency Start" and "Frequency Stop" values (FREQ key > "Frequency Con-
fig" softkey).
5. Press the INPUT/OUTPUT key and select "External Generator Config".
6. In the "Interface Configuration" subtab, select the "Generator Type" connected to
the R&S
FSW.
If the required generator type is not available, define a new setup file as described
in
"To define a new generator setup file"
7. Select the type of interface and the address used to connect the generator to the
R&S
FSW.
8. If the generator supports "TTL Synchronization", activate this function.
9. Select "Reference: External" to synchronize the analyzer with the generator.
10. Switch to the "Measurement Configuration" subtab.
11. Set the "Source State" to "On".
12. Define the generator output level as the "Source Power".
13. Optionally, to define a constant level offset for the external generator, define a
"Source Offset".
14. The default frequency list for the calibration sweep contains 1001 values, divided in
equi-distant frequencies between the R&S
FSW's start and stop frequency. For
most cases, this automatic coupling should be correct. Check the "Result Fre-
quency Start" and "Result Frequency Stop" values to make sure the required mea-
surement span is covered. If necessary, change the frequency settings on the
R&S
FSW (FREQ key > "Frequency Config" softkey), or use a different generator
type.
15. Switch to the "Source Calibration" subtab.
16. Select the "Source Calibration Type": "Transmission" to perform a calibration
sweep and store a reference trace for the measurement setup.
17. Select "Source Calibration Normalize": "On".
